CHARGES: Mr Escott alleged that Mr Todd (SUPER SASSY) drove in a manner which interfered with REACHER (G Shand) with 900 m to run when attempting to shift REACHER down on the track.

--

 

--

Mr Todd indicated that he admitted the breach and did not wish to attend the hearing or to be represented. Mr Escott confirmed these matters orally. We thus find the charge proved.

--

 

--

FACTS: Mr Escott had Mr Renault demonstrate on the videos that when racing towards the rear of the field Mr Todd moved from 4 wide to 3 wide and in so doing squeezed REACHER for room. The consequence was that that horse broke and lost all chance.

--

 

--

SUBMISSIONS AS TO PENALTY: Mr Escott produced Mr Todd’s record, which was clear. He informed the Committee that Mr Todd had had some 175 drives in this time. He submitted a fine of $200 was appropriate.

--

 

--

DECISION: We view the breach as being mid range. Mr Todd’s actions have cost REACHER any chance it had of filling a dividend bearing position. Mr Todd has an excellent record and has admitted the breach at the first opportunity. We believe the matter can be dealt with by way of a fine rather than a suspension and fine Mr Todd the sum of $200.
